Output 7423a96fb204a1dc372e2f77a68e8b205ad25b51ecbf17062a11d59a6d795d11:5
- value
- 268590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24ec5132516d09177805f2f64920a6cfcecc97f9 OP_EQUAL
- address
- 354FM48THxYS9LujoehUHXYVCCu9AzBD34
- transaction
- 7423a96fb204a1dc372e2f77a68e8b205ad25b51ecbf17062a11d59a6d795d11
- confirmations
- 312018
- spent
- true